Hey there! My name is Joan, and I am a Senior from Brooklyn, NY pursuing a BBA from Ross and a minor in Art & Design from STAMPS. Growing up, I loved to partake in creative hobbies such as painting and photography, and I wanted to intersect my passions in art with my interest in business by creating a direct, positive impact on society, which I found marketing to be the perfect intersection of both. At Ross, I am able to make my dream more tangible by the day through the nurturing community of faculty and students who have shaped my experiences as a BBA student. 

Coming from a densely populated city like New York, I was pretty nervous and scared to be traveling to a state far away from home and my family. I had no idea what was in store for me in a college experience as a first generation student, but through opportunities like Ross Preview Weekend and Ross Summer Connection, I quickly grew accustomed to this new life and embraced the Go Blue! spirit. It's crazy to think that I am now in my final stretch as I work to complete my degree, but I couldn't have asked for a better experience than my time at Ross. From my BA200 professor who shaped my career interests to meeting so many of my amazing peers in classes and clubs, I have truly found my home away from home, as corny as that may sound. Even outside of Ross, I have found ways to continue my passions and make new friends by being a photographer running a side hustle on campus.
